Create Mechanical Chicken [1.21.1] [1.20.1]
If you're sick of building laggy, massive chicken farms just to get eggs for your Create machines, this mod is a total lifesaver. It adds a single "Mechanical Chicken" block that uses rotation and seeds to churn out eggs or even seed oil without the mess. You can tweak the processing time and outputs, and it even has a Ponder scene so you aren't left guessing how it works. It’s on Forge and NeoForge for 1.20.1 and 1.21.1, though you’ll need Mechanicals Lib for the newer versions.

Splendid Slimes [1.20.1]
If you’ve ever played Slime Rancher and wished those bouncy guys were in Minecraft, Splendid Slimes is basically that dream come true. It adds about 19 different species that you can actually ranch, and they all have their own favorite foods and weird quirks, like some that literally explode or just float away if you aren't watching. You get a Slime Vac to suck them up and move them around, which feels way more satisfying than just using a lead. The whole loop is about feeding them to get plorts, which you can then turn into high-end resources or use in an incubator to grow even more slimes.
